Thousands of tourists visit the beaches of Mexico every year, however, surprisingly, very few know that our country is fourth in the world for biodiversity, due to its large number of species of flora and fauna.

Ecotourism in Guerrero has gained strength due to its great diversity, and one of the best places to enjoy it is in Ixtapa Zihuatanejo.

Here, in addition cycling through the cycle path and Aztlán Park, you can observe birds and other species of the region there. You can even find specialized bird watching tours. Ixtapa Zihuatanejo is a hidden treasure, since there are records of bird watching with MORE than 320 different species, as well as iguanas, crocodiles, and other reptiles. The most common birds that can be observed are the pink spoonbill, chachalacas, brown pelican, brown bobo, Goldenfoot Egret, Parakeets, Magpies, Green Heron and more.
